55问答网
所有问题
当前搜索:
编译程序的五个过程
c语言
编译器的
工作
过程
是怎样的?
答:
编译程序的工作过程一般划分为五个阶段:词法分析、语法分析、语义分析、优化、目标代码生成
。( 1 )词法分析:也就是从左到右一个一个的读入源程序,识别一个单词或符号,并进行归类。( 2 )语法分析: 在词法分析的基础上,将单词序列分解成各类语法短语,如“程序”,“语句”,“表达式”等。(...
编制计算机
程序
解决问题时,一般分为
五个过程
:分析问题、设计算法、编...
答:
A[解析]计算机程序解决问题的过程是:
分析问题—设计算法—编写程序—调试运行—检测结果
。
什么是
编译
,如何实现编译?
答:
当编写完一个
程序
后,需要首先进行
编译
,然后再运行。如下图所示,程序编写完毕后,点击工具栏中的Execute,选择compile(编译)如果没有错误,再选择Execute,选择run(运行)
编译程序的
各阶段都涉及到什么
答:
预处理,词法分析,文法分析,生成中间代码,生成目标代码
。1、预处理:导入源程序并保存(C文件)。2、编译:将源程序转换为目标文件(Obj文件)。3、链接:将目标文件生成为可执行文件(EXE文件)。
编译
和解释
程序
都是什么
答:
1、利用编译程序从源语言编写的源程序产生目标程序的过程。2、用编译程序产生目标程序的动作。 编译就是把高级语言变成计算机可以识别的2进制语言,计算机只认识1和0,编译程序把人们熟悉的语言换成2进制的。 编译程序把一个源程序翻译成目标程序的工作过程分为五个阶段:
词法分析
;语法分析;语义检查和...
什么是Java代码的
编译
与反编译?
答:
1、利用编译程序从源语言编写的源程序产生目标程序的过程。2、用编译程序产生目标程序的动作。编译就是把高级语言变成计算机可以识别的2进制语言,计算机只认识1和0,编译程序把人们熟悉的语言换成2进制的。编译程序把一个源程序翻译成目标程序的工作过程分为五个阶段:
词法分析
;语法分析;语义检查和中间代码...
程序
化教学
五个步骤
答:
程序
化教学
五个步骤
第一步就是分析需求:我们需要知道我们编程目的是什么,才能接下去变成电脑语言。第二步是设计算法:根据所需的功能,理清思路,排出完成功能的具体步骤,其中每一步都应当是简单的、确定的。这一步也被称为“逻辑编程”。第三步是编写程序:根据前一步设计的算法,编写...
在
编译过程
中,进行类型分析和检查是( )阶段一个主要工作。
答:
词法分析
阶段是编译过程第一阶段,这个阶段任务是对源程序从前到后(从左到右)逐个字符地扫描,从中识别出一个个“单词”符号。语法分析任务是在词法分析基础上,根据语言语法规则将单词符号序列分解成各类语法单位,如“表达式”、“语句”和“程序”等。语义分析阶段主要分析程序中各种语法结构语义信息,...
计算机
程序的编译
方式有哪些?
答:
1、利用编译程序从源语言编写的源程序产生目标程序的过程。2、用编译程序产生目标程序的动作。 编译就是把高级语言变成计算机可以识别的2进制语言,计算机只认识1和0,编译程序把人们熟悉的语言换成2进制的。编译程序把一个源程序翻译成目标程序的工作过程分为五个阶段:
词法分析
;语法分析;语义检查和中间...
上机操作c语言
程序
一般经过哪些
步骤
答:
编辑源代码。二、把源码
编译
成目标程序(二进制程序)三、把目标程序和其它库文件链接起来形成可执行程序四、调试、运行
程序五
、如果有错误,再从头开始执行。上机输入和编辑
源程序
。通过键盘向计算机输入程序,如发现有错误,要及时改正。最后将此源程序以文件形式存放在自己指定的文件夹内(如果不特别指定,...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
程序编译过程的三个主要步骤
编译程序的过程
编译程序的工作过程
编译程序和汇编程序
简述编译程序的工作过程
编译程序的结构和工作过程
编译程序与解释程序的区别
编译程序是一种什么程序
c程序编译后生成什么程序